        private static void transferProc(object o)
        {
            TransferQueue queue = (TransferQueue)o;

            while (queue.Running && queue.Index < queue.Length)
            {
                queue.pauseEvent.WaitOne();

                if (!queue.Running)
                {
                    break;
                }
                lock (file_buffer)
                {
                    queue.FS.Position = queue.Index;

                    int read = queue.FS.Read(file_buffer, 0, file_buffer.Length);

                    PacketWriter pw = new PacketWriter();

                    pw.Write((byte)Headers.Chunk);
                    pw.Write(queue.ID);
                    pw.Write(queue.Index);
                    pw.Write(read);
                    pw.Write(file_buffer, 0, read);

                    queue.Transferred += read;
                    queue.Index       += read;

                    queue.Client.Send(pw.GetBytes()); //error !!!!! occured

                    queue.Progress = (int)((queue.Transferred * 100) / queue.Length);

                    if (queue.LastProgress < queue.Progress)
                    {
                        queue.LastProgress = queue.Progress;


                        queue.Client.callProgressChanged(queue);
                    }

                    Thread.Sleep(1);
                }
            }
            queue.Close();
        }

        private void process()
        {
            PacketReader pr = new PacketReader(_buffer);

            Headers header = (Headers)pr.ReadByte();

            switch (header)
            {
            case Headers.Queue:
            {
                int    id       = pr.ReadInt32();
                string fileName = pr.ReadString();
                long   length   = pr.ReadInt64();


                TransferQueue queue = TransferQueue.CreateDownloadQueue(this, id, Path.Combine(OutputFolder,
                                                                                               Path.GetFileName(fileName)), length);
                _transfers.Add(id, queue);

                if (Queued != null)
                {
                    Queued(this, queue);
                }
            }
            break;

            case Headers.Start:
            {
                int id = pr.ReadInt32();
                if (_transfers.ContainsKey(id))
                {
                    _transfers[id].Start();
                }
            }
            break;

            case Headers.Stop:
            {
                int id = pr.ReadInt32();
                if (_transfers.ContainsKey(id))
                {
                    TransferQueue queue = _transfers[id];
                    queue.Stop();
                    queue.Close();
                    if (Stopped != null)
                    {
                        Stopped(this, queue);
                        _transfers.Remove(id);
                    }
                }
            }
            break;

            case Headers.Pause:
            {
                int id = pr.ReadInt32();
                if (_transfers.ContainsKey(id))
                {
                    _transfers[id].Pause();
                }
            }
            break;

            case Headers.Chunk:
            {
                int    id     = pr.ReadInt32();
                long   index  = pr.ReadInt64();
                int    size   = pr.ReadInt32();
                byte[] buffer = pr.ReadBytes(size);

                TransferQueue queue = _transfers[id];
                queue.Write(buffer, index);
                queue.Progress = (int)((queue.Transferred * 100) / queue.Length);
                if (queue.LastProgress < queue.Progress)
                {
                    if (ProgressChanged != null)
                    {
                        ProgressChanged(this, queue);
                    }
                    if (queue.Progress == 100)
                    {
                        queue.Close();


                        if (Complete != null)
                        {
                            Complete(this, queue);
                        }
                    }
                }
            }
            break;
            }
            pr.Dispose();
        }
